SAP security note 1602328, “Directory traversal in PY-FR”, is released on November 8, 2011. Below are the symptom and SAP recommended solution.
Description
Symptom
This security note addresses a directory traversal vulnerability in the PY-FR component of SAP Payroll. A malicious user can exploit this vulnerability to write arbitrary files on the remote server, potentially leading to data corruption or altered system behavior.
Exploiting this vulnerability allows unauthorized file creation on the server, which can compromise data integrity and system functionality.
Solution
To mitigate this vulnerability:
- Use the ‘Path and file name’ Field: When executing the program in the background, use the ‘Path and file name’ field on the selection screen to store the output list in a file on the application server. When executing the program in the foreground, utilize the ‘Download’ feature in the ALV display to save the list to a file.
- Implement Prerequisite Corrections: Refer to SAP Note 1497003 for additional information and instructions. Ensure that the corrections from SAP Note 1497003 are implemented as they are prerequisites for this note.
